Julie Griffith
Julie began her volleyball career as a Logan-Rogersville Wildcat. In high school, she earned All-Conference and All-District honors and was an All-State selection her senior year. After high school, she attended Evangel University to play volleyball and pursue a degree in Music Education. During her time as a Crusader, she earned top honors including two-time All-American and All-Region selection and team MVP in 2007 and 2008. In 2008, she became the first Crusader to earn All-America honors from the American Volleyball Coaches Association.
After college, she enjoyed keeping up with the game by playing many years of women's and co-ed leagues. From 2011-2017 she served as Assistant Coach of the Aurora Hown’ Dawgs, alongside then head Coach Susan Patterson. In 2019 she was inducted into the Evangel Hall of Fame and in 2022 she was a Wynn Award recipient through the Missouri Sports Hall of Fame. Currently, Julie resides in Republic, MO with her husband, James, and two kids, Hattie, 4, and Eli, 2. She has been a vocal music educator in Aurora, MO for the last 14 years. |
